Pravity
Pronunciation : Prav"i*ty
Part of Speech : n.
Etymology : [L. pravitas, from pravus crooked, perverse.]
Definition : Defn: Deterioration; degeneracy; corruption; especially, moral crookedness; moral perversion; perverseness; depravity; as, the pravity of human nature. "The pravity of the will." South.
Source : Webster's Unabridged Dictionary, 1913
